Use Actions safely

Let the agent collect details, book meetings, create tickets, search the web, and call approved tools.

Choose the outcome first

Create Actions for repeated next steps: lead capture, appointment booking, ticket handoff, Shopify assistance, forms, buttons, suggested replies, web search, or selected OpenAPI operations. Each Action should have a clear purpose and approval boundary.

Collect clean fields

Ask for the minimum information needed to complete the Action. Use forms, guided questions, and buttons when structured fields matter, especially for contact details, order identifiers, booking preferences, and ticket summaries.

Explain what happened

After an Action runs, the agent should summarize the result in plain language and make the next step obvious. If the tool fails or the request is risky, the agent should escalate instead of pretending the workflow succeeded.
